HONGKONG: 1937, 50 C black/green cancelled with double-circle on crash-cover adressed to England, the "Imperial Airways liner "Cygnus" crashed at Brindisi while homeward bound with mails from the East, frame cancel "DAMAGED BY SEA WATER", (Image)
